How much does a Systems Security Professional - Senior make in Camargo, IL? The average Systems Security Professional - Senior salary in Camargo, IL is $114,100 as of May 28, 2024, but the range typically falls between $101,060 and $127,910.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. The Systems Security Professional - Senior recommends and develops security measures to protect information against unauthorized modification or loss. Analyzes information security systems and applications and finds the vulnerabilities. Being a Systems Security Professional - Senior requires a bachelor's degree. Coordinates with development teams or third parties to fix systems/application vulnerabilities. In addition, Systems Security Professional - Senior typically reports to a manager. Being a Systems Security Professional - Senior cont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. Working as a Systems Security Professional - Senior typically requires 4 to 7 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
